Joel Isaacson & Co's Q3 2025 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2025, Joel Isaacson & Co held 456 positions worth $2.77B, up 13% from $2.46B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 56% of the portfolio.

Joel Isaacson & Co deployed $99.2M of net new capital in Q3 2025, opening 38 new positions and adding to 228 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Vanguard Short-Term Inflation-Protected Securities Index Fund: 12,173 shares worth $616K.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Communication Services at 12% of assets, up from 11%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Financials.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Alphabet (Google) Class C, an estimated $7.22M trimmed.
